The reality is, our brains are wired to latch onto negativity—a phenomenon known as the ‘negativity bias.’ This survival mechanism, honed over generations, served our ancestors well in a world fraught with danger. But in our modern, relatively safe society, this bias can often lead us astray.

Think about it: how often do we dwell on a single criticism, ignoring a chorus of compliments? It’s as if our minds have a default setting for negativity, amplifying every perceived threat while drowning out moments of joy and gratitude.

And the consequences can be profound. Constantly dwelling on negativity not only robs us of happiness but can also spiral into a cycle of self-doubt and despair. It’s a vicious cycle—one that’s all too familiar to many of us.

One powerful antidote to negativity is gratitude. By consciously acknowledging the things we’re thankful for—whether it’s a warm embrace from a loved one or the simple beauty of nature—we can train our brains to focus on the positive. Studies have shown that cultivating gratitude not only boosts our mood but also enhances our resilience in the face of adversity.

Similarly, nurturing our physical and social well-being can help counteract the pull of negativity. Regular exercise, time spent outdoors, and meaningful connections with others are all vital ingredients for a happy, fulfilling life.

But perhaps the most potent elixir of all is altruism—the act of giving selflessly to others. Whether it’s volunteering at a local shelter or simply lending a listening ear to a friend in need, acts of kindness have a remarkable power to lift our spirits and foster a sense of connection and purpose.
